Transaction 423a85ef05a81986fa3e83808708c7e06f0af64cea489a069d513d3f47943170

14 Input
2 Outputs
  • 423a85ef05a81986fa3e83808708c7e06f0af64cea489a069d513d3f47943170:0
  • value  12000000
    address  14upWpv4AS8amCQVhU5DogzxW1VQdyVFBv
  • 423a85ef05a81986fa3e83808708c7e06f0af64cea489a069d513d3f47943170:1
  • value  21935773
    address  3AtmTqcDXvmiF98sLUVx8738p6m62SdQTH